Output 83f86664848f7fbaeffea9b140c590409f290573f4e382d65a92744944d5084d:1

value
309364
script pubkey
OP_0 OP_PUSHBYTES_20 8a91962d21a930befeb5d0f1ee80695e519fd45a
address
bc1q32gevtfp4yctal446rc7aqrftegel4z6md3wj6
transaction
83f86664848f7fbaeffea9b140c590409f290573f4e382d65a92744944d5084d
spent
true